Press Freedoms Continue to Be Curtailed in Syria

Syria was ranked 174 out of 180 states by Reporters Without Borders, although they did not address journalists imprisoned in Syria, as there is no reliable data writes Ana Press.

Syria Imposes New Fuel Rations as Sanctions Bite

Blaming Western sanctions for the crisis, Syria had imposed tough sanctions on people’s fuel consumption, limiting how much and how often they can fill up their vehicles writes Asharq al-Awsat.
